不能复制和解决EXC_CRASH SIGKILL苹果提交

问题描述 投票:0回答:1

最近我从苹果的应用程序被拒绝(首次提交)由于错误信息EXC_CRASH SIGKILL。在审查意见中提到的应用程序是崩溃的启动。我理解这个错误可能与iOS的12,火力地堡,或我的应用程序只是时间太长加载。

我想调试,但我无法复制在我结束这个bug。我已经直接从Xcode的部署,并通过testFlight测试,我很遗憾没能复制。该应用程序加载没有任何问题。

我怎样才能最终复制(通过testFlight或Xcode中)和解决这个问题?

异常类型:EXC_CRASH(SIGKILL)异常代码:0x0000000000000000,0x0000000000000000异常注:EXC_CORPSE_NOTIFY终止原因:命名空间跳板代码0x8badf00d终止说明:跳板,场景创建看门狗侵:*********疲惫的真实(挂钟)17.77秒计时津贴| ProcessVisibility:前景| ProcessState:运行| WatchdogEvent:场景制作| WatchdogVisibility:前景| WatchdogCPUStatistics:(| “经过的总CPU时间(秒):37.550(用户37.550,系统0.000),63%的CPU”,| “经历应用CPU时间(秒):1.015,2%CPU” |)由螺纹:0触发

ios swift xcode firebase
1个回答
2
投票

这里是答案https://developer.apple.com/library/archive/technotes/tn2151/_index.html

异常代码0x8badf00d指出一个应用程序已经被终止的iOS因为看门狗超时发生。该应用程序时间太长启动,终止或响应系统事件。这方面的一个常见原因是主线程做同步联网。无论操作上螺纹0需要移动到后台线程,或不同地处理,以使得它不会阻塞主线程。

这里是这个崩溃https://developer.apple.com/library/archive/technotes/tn2151/_index.html的原因

© www.soinside.com 2019 - 2024. All rights reserved.